X-Plane 10.30+ Lockheed Sirius 8 "Tingmissartoq". The Lockheed Model 8 Sirius was a single-engined, propeller-driven monoplane designed and built by Jack Northrop and Gerard Vultee while they were engineers at Lockheed in 1929, at the request of Charles Lindbergh. The "Tingmissartoq" Lockheed Sirius 8 was the plane flown by Charles Lindbergh and his wife Anne Morrow Lindbergh. The aircraft presented here had been reengineed with a 710 hp Wright Cyclone.
